@media only screen and (width>=0){#hero{z-index:1;padding:clamp(20rem,25.95vw,18.75em) 1rem;position:relative;overflow:hidden}#hero .graphic-dark{color:var(--dark)}#hero .container{flex-wrap:wrap;justify-content:flex-start;align-items:center;gap:3rem;width:100%;max-width:80rem;margin:auto;display:flex}#hero .content{text-align:left;z-index:1;flex-direction:column;align-items:flex-start;width:100%;max-width:46.875rem;display:flex;position:relative}#hero .title{letter-spacing:-2px;max-width:100%;font-size:clamp(3.0625rem,6vw,5.25rem)}#hero .title,#hero .text{text-align:left;color:var(--bodyTextColorWhite)}#hero .text{margin-bottom:2rem}#hero .content-graphic{z-index:-1;z-index:-3;width:auto;height:305%;max-height:81.25rem;position:absolute;top:50%;left:auto;right:-4rem;transform:translateY(-50%)}#hero .graphic{-o-object-fit:cover;object-fit:cover;z-index:2;width:100%;min-width:120rem;height:auto;position:absolute;bottom:-1px;left:50%;transform:translate(-50%)}#hero .graphic-dark{display:none}#hero .background{z-index:-2;width:100%;height:100%;margin-top:10rem;display:block;position:absolute;top:0;left:0}#hero .background:before{content:"";pointer-events:none;opacity:.5;z-index:1;background:#000;width:100%;height:100%;display:block;position:absolute;top:0;left:0}#hero .background img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0}}@media only screen and (width>=120rem){#hero{padding-bottom:14vw}}@media only screen and (width>=0){body.dark-mode #hero .graphic{display:none}body.dark-mode #hero .graphic-dark{display:block}#about-us{padding:var(--sectionPadding);z-index:1;background-color:#222;padding-bottom:clamp(6.25rem,8vw,12.5rem);position:relative;overflow:hidden}#about-us .container{flex-direction:column;align-items:center;gap:clamp(3rem,6vw,4rem);width:100%;max-width:34.375rem;margin:auto;display:flex}#about-us .content{text-align:left;z-index:3;flex-direction:column;align-items:flex-start;width:100%;max-width:33.875rem;display:flex;position:relative}#about-us .title,#about-us .text{color:var(--bodyTextColorWhite)}#about-us .text{opacity:.8;margin-bottom:1rem}#about-us .text:last-of-type{margin-bottom:2rem}#about-us .ul{-moz-column-gap:.75rem;grid-template-columns:repeat(12,1fr);gap:1rem .75rem;width:100%;max-width:39.375rem;margin:0 0 2rem;padding:0;display:grid}#about-us .li{flex-direction:column;grid-column:span 4;justify-content:flex-start;align-items:flex-start;gap:clamp(1rem,2.5vw,1.25rem);margin:0;padding:0;list-style:none;display:flex}#about-us .li-picture{z-index:1;border-radius:50%;flex:none;justify-content:center;align-items:center;width:3rem;height:3rem;margin:0;display:flex;position:relative}#about-us .li-picture:before{content:"";z-index:-1;background:#1d1c1c;width:100%;height:100%;display:block;position:absolute;top:0;left:0}#about-us .li-icon{width:1.5rem;height:auto;display:block}#about-us .h3{text-transform:uppercase;letter-spacing:.1em;text-align:left;color:var(--bodyTextColorWhite);opacity:.8;margin:0 0 .75rem;font-size:clamp(.8125rem,2vw,1rem);font-weight:700;line-height:1.2em}#about-us .li-text{text-align:left;color:var(--bodyTextColorWhite);margin:0;font-size:1.25rem;font-weight:700;line-height:1.2em}#about-us .topper{color:#fff}#about-us .image-group{z-index:1;width:40.1875em;height:38em;font-size:min(2vw,.7rem);position:relative}#about-us .picture{-o-object-fit:cover;object-fit:cover;width:100%;height:100%;display:block;position:absolute}#about-us .picture img{-o-object-fit:cover;object-fit:cover;width:100%;height:100%}#about-us .mask{-o-object-fit:cover;object-fit:cover;z-index:1;width:101%;height:101%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}#about-us .graphic{-o-object-fit:cover;object-fit:cover;z-index:1;width:100%;min-width:75rem;height:auto;position:absolute;bottom:0;left:50%;transform:translate(-50%)}#about-us .dark{display:none}}@media only screen and (width>=48rem){#about-us .container{flex-direction:row;justify-content:space-between;align-items:center;max-width:80rem}#about-us .image-group{flex:none;font-size:min(1vw,1rem)}#about-us .image-group:before{display:block}#about-us .content{width:51%}}@media only screen and (width>=81.25rem){#about-us .image-group{font-size:inherit}#about-us .li{flex-direction:row}}@media only screen and (width>=125rem){#about-us{padding-bottom:9vw}}@media only screen and (width>=0){body.dark-mode #about-us .light{display:none}body.dark-mode #about-us .dark{color:var(--dark);display:block}#faq{padding:var(--sectionPadding);position:relative}#faq .container{flex-direction:column;align-items:center;gap:clamp(2rem,6vw,3rem);width:100%;max-width:36.5rem;margin:auto;display:flex}#faq .content{text-align:center;flex-direction:column;align-items:center;width:100%;display:flex}#faq .title{margin:0 0 clamp(2rem,5vw,3rem)}#faq .picture{width:100%;height:clamp(22.5rem,54vw,25rem);display:block;position:relative}#faq .picture img{-o-object-fit:cover;object-fit:cover;border-radius:var(--borderRadius);width:100%;height:100%}#faq .faq-group{flex-direction:column;justify-content:center;align-items:center;gap:.75rem;width:100%;max-width:40.625rem;margin:0;padding:0;display:flex}#faq .faq-item{border-radius:var(--borderRadius);background-color:#f7f7f7;width:100%;list-style:none;transition:border-bottom .3s;overflow:hidden}#faq .faq-item.active .button{color:var(--primaryDark)}#faq .faq-item.active .button:before{background-color:var(--primaryDark);transform:rotate(315deg)}#faq .faq-item.active .button:after{background-color:var(--primaryDark);transform:rotate(-315deg)}#faq .faq-item.active .item-p{opacity:1;height:auto;padding:0 clamp(1rem,2vw,1.5rem) clamp(1.25rem,1.3vw,1.5rem)}#faq .button{text-align:left;color:var(--headerColor);background-color:#f7f7f7;border:none;width:100%;padding:clamp(1.25rem,2vw,1.5rem);font-size:clamp(1rem,2.5vw,1.25rem);font-weight:700;line-height:1.2em;transition:background-color .3s,color .3s;display:block;position:relative}#faq .button:hover{cursor:pointer}#faq .button:before{content:"";background-color:var(--headerColor);opacity:1;transform-origin:0;border-radius:50%;width:.5rem;height:.125rem;transition:transform .5s;display:block;position:absolute;top:50%;right:1.5rem;transform:rotate(45deg)}#faq .button:after{content:"";background-color:var(--headerColor);opacity:1;transform-origin:100%;border-radius:50%;width:.5rem;height:.125rem;transition:transform .5s;display:block;position:absolute;top:50%;right:1.3125rem;transform:rotate(-45deg)}#faq .button-text{width:80%;display:block}#faq .item-p{opacity:0;width:90%;height:0;color:var(--bodyTextColor);margin:0;padding:0 clamp(1rem,2vw,1.5rem);font-size:clamp(.875rem,1.5vw,1rem);line-height:1.5em;transition:opacity .3s,padding-bottom .3s;overflow:hidden}}@media only screen and (width>=64rem){#faq .container{flex-direction:row;justify-content:space-between;align-items:stretch;max-width:80rem}#faq .content{text-align:left;flex:none;order:2;align-items:flex-start;width:40%}}@media only screen and (width>=0){body.dark-mode #faq .title,body.dark-mode #faq .item-p{color:var(--bodyTextColorWhite)}body.dark-mode #faq .faq-item{background-color:var(--accent)}body.dark-mode #faq .faq-item.active .button{background-color:var(--primaryDark);color:var(--bodyTextColorWhite)}body.dark-mode #faq .faq-item.active .button:before,body.dark-mode #faq .faq-item.active .button:after{background-color:var(--bodyTextColorWhite)}body.dark-mode #faq .faq-item.active .item-p{padding-top:clamp(1.25rem,1.3vw,1.5rem)}body.dark-mode #faq .button{background-color:var(--accent);color:var(--bodyTextColorWhite)}body.dark-mode #faq .button:before,body.dark-mode #faq .button:after{background-color:var(--bodyTextColorWhite)}#services-1976{padding:var(--sectionPadding);position:relative;overflow:hidden}#services-1976:before{content:"";opacity:.05;z-index:-1;width:100%;height:100%;position:absolute;top:0;left:0}#services-1976 .container{flex-direction:column;align-items:center;gap:clamp(3rem,6vw,4rem);width:100%;max-width:80rem;margin:auto;display:flex}#services-1976 .content{text-align:center;flex-direction:column;align-items:center;width:100%;display:flex}#services-1976 .wrapper{flex-direction:column;align-items:flex-start;gap:clamp(3rem,6vw,4rem);width:100%;display:flex}#services-1976 .ul{flex-direction:column;align-items:flex-start;gap:2rem;width:100%;max-width:39.375rem;margin:0;padding:0;display:flex}#services-1976 .li{border-bottom:1px solid var(--primaryLight);justify-content:flex-start;align-items:center;gap:clamp(1.25rem,3.5vw,2rem);margin:0;padding:0 0 2rem;list-style:none;display:flex}#services-1976 .li:last-of-type{border:none;padding:0}#services-1976 .li-picture{z-index:1;flex:none;justify-content:center;align-items:center;margin:0;display:flex;position:relative;overflow:hidden}#services-1976 .li-icon{width:clamp(4rem,8vw,5rem);height:auto;display:block}#services-1976 .h3{text-align:left;color:var(--headerColor);margin:0 0 1rem;font-size:clamp(1.25rem,2.5vw,1.5625rem);font-weight:700;line-height:1.2em;transition:color .3s}#services-1976 .li-text{text-align:left;color:var(--bodyTextColor);margin:0;font-size:1rem;line-height:1.5em}#services-1976 .card-group{grid-template-columns:repeat(12,1fr);gap:clamp(1rem,2vw,1.25rem);width:100%;margin:0 auto;padding:0;display:grid}#services-1976 .item{text-align:left;box-sizing:border-box;border-radius:var(--borderRadius);z-index:1;background-color:#fff;flex-direction:column;grid-area:span 1/span 12;gap:clamp(1.5rem,3.2vw,2rem);width:100%;margin:0 auto;padding:clamp(1.5rem,3.2vw,2rem);list-style:none;transition:border .3s;display:flex;position:relative}#services-1976 .item:hover .h3{color:var(--secondary)}#services-1976 .item-text{max-width:28.125rem;color:var(--bodyTextColor);margin:0 0 1.5rem;padding:0;font-size:1rem;line-height:1.5em}#services-1976 .link{text-align:inherit;color:var(--primary);border-bottom:1px solid var(--primary);margin-top:auto;font-size:1rem;font-weight:700;line-height:1.2em;text-decoration:none}#services-1976 .picture{justify-content:flex-start;margin:0;padding:2rem 0;display:flex;position:relative;overflow:hidden}}@media only screen and (width>=48rem){#services-1976 .content{text-align:left;align-items:flex-start}#services-1976 .wrapper{flex-direction:row}#services-1976 .ul{width:90%;max-width:23.125rem}}@media only screen and (width>=64rem){#services-1976 .ul{flex:none;width:37vw;max-width:36.625rem}#services-1976 .item{grid-column:span 6}}@media only screen and (width>=0){body.dark-mode #services-1976 .item{background-color:var(--medium)}body.dark-mode #services-1976 .title,body.dark-mode #services-1976 .text,body.dark-mode #services-1976 .h3,body.dark-mode #services-1976 .li-text,body.dark-mode #services-1976 .item-text{color:var(--bodyTextColorWhite)}body.dark-mode #services-1976 .text,body.dark-mode #services-1976 .li-text,body.dark-mode #services-1976 .item-text{opacity:.8}}
